Title
Committee of Imperial Defence, Principal Supply Officers Committee: Minutes and Memoranda (PSO Series)
Date

1924-1939

Description

This series consists of minutes, memoranda and reports of the Principal Supply Officers Committee (PSO), the minutes and memoranda of the Supply Board, and the minutes and papers of sub-committees appointed by both the PSO and by the Supply Board.

Subjects covered include all issues concerned with the supply of armaments, engineering tools, scientific materials, raw materials, foodstuffs and medical supplies, and the location of war-like stores.

Administrative / biographical background

The Principal Supply Officers Committee (PSO) was set up in 1924 under the Master of the Ordnance's aegis. It was reconstituted in 1927 under the Board of Trade. From 1936, the Minister for the Co-ordination of Defence became Chairman. The PSO functioned largely through sub-committees whose work was co-ordinated by the Supply Board.

After 1927, the PSO was designated wider functions of locating capacity and considering the expansion of industry.
